Abstract

Described herein are methods, systems, and software for accommodating failover of a content node in a content delivery network. In one example, a method of operating a control node includes receiving content requests issued by end user devices. The method further provides, for at least a first content request, mapping a first connection between a first end user device and a first content node, the first connection defined by at least a network address of the first end user device and a virtual next hop network address, and directing traffic associated with the first connection to the first content node using at least the virtual next hop network address. The method also includes identifying a service interruption associated with the first content node and, responsive to the service interruption, identifying a second content node to handle the communications for the first connection.
